A balanced delta connected load takes 20 KVA at 0.8 power factor when connected to a 415 v, 3 sigma system.Calculate the resistance of each branch of balanced star connected non reactive load which when connected to same supply coil takes the same power?

The active power per each phase (since the load is balanced, it means that all branches have the same impedance) can be calculated as


"P=\\frac{S\\space\\text{cos}\\phi}{\\sqrt{3}}."

With non-reactive load each phase of the star-connected load has power of


"P=\\frac{U^2_\\text{phase}}{R_\\text{branch}},"

and therefore


"R_\\text{branch}=\\frac{U^2_\\text{phase}}{P}=\\frac{\\sqrt{3}\\cdot U^2_\\text{phase}}{S\\space\\text{cos}\\phi}=\\frac{\\sqrt{3}\\cdot [U^2_\\text{line}\/3]}{S\\space\\text{cos}\\phi},"

"R_\\text{branch}=\\frac{\\sqrt{3}\\cdot 415^2\/3}{20000\\cdot0.8}=6.21\\space\\Omega."
